NGC 3327 - galaxy in the constellation Leonis Minoris
Type: Sb - spiral galaxy
The angular dimensions: 1.10'x0.8'
magnitude: V=13.4m; B=14.2m
The surface brightness: 13.1 mag/arcmin2
Coordinates for epoch J2000: Ra= 10h39m57.8s; Dec= 24°5'30"
redshift (z): 0.021025
The distance from the Sun to NGC 3327: based on the amount of redshift (z) - 88.8 Mpc;
Other names of the object NGC 3327 : PGC 31729, UGC 5803, MCG 4-25-38, CGCG 124-51
